LEARNING OBJECTIVES
Part 1: Understanding and supporting transgender youth
Review developmental understanding of gender identity formation in youth and gender identity terminology
Define a support without steering approach to pediatric and adolescent gender identity
Define what constitutes “gender affirming care” for youth at different ages and stages
Part 2: Recognizing and addressing disinformation regarding transgender youth
Explore the current political landscape for transgender youth and origins of current state
Review impact on transgender youth health and mental health of current policies and politics
Develop skills to recognize and address disinformation about transgender youth and their healthcare
Part 3: Navigating difficult conversations about transgender youth
Review a best practice approach to supporting transgender and gender diverse youth
Introduce strategies to approaching difficult questions and conversations with families and parents/guardians
Provide perspective and advice on supporting the “unsupportive” parent or guardian.


Name: Dr. Kade Goepferd
Title: Chief Education Officer, Clinical Director, Equity and Inclusion
Pediatrician, Gender Health Program
Kade Goepferd, MD, is the Chief Education Officer at Children’s Minnesota and founder of Children’s Gender Health Program. For over 20 years, Dr. Goepferd has been a leader in the LGBTQIA+ community who is driving equitable care for LGBTQIA+ youth, particularly transgender and gender diverse youth, and is a sought-after speaker and trainer on these topics. In 2019, Dr. Goepferd launched the Children’s Gender Health Program, the largest multispecialty exclusively pediatric program in the region. In October of 2020, their first TED talk, “The revolutionary truth about kids and gender identity” was released by TEDx Minneapolis. As an advocate and educator, they have received multiple professional and community awards including two special recognition awards from the American Academy of Pediatrics in 2019 and 2023 and the distinguished Ellen Perrin Award for Excellence in LGBTQ Health and Wellness from the American Academy of Pediatrics in 2022, they also served as Grand Marshall for the Twin Cities Pride Parade in June 2023. When they are not advocating for kids professionally, they are busy parenting 3 kids of their own, including coaching youth basketball year-round.
